China Eases Rare Earth Export Rules Following U.S. Trade Truce

Following the US-China trade truce, Beijing has started granting general export licenses for rare earths, easing a bureaucratic process that underscores China’s dominance over the critical minerals supply.

The tit-for-tat trade war between the US and China earlier this year cooled by late October after President Trump and President Xi agreed to a trade truce that, so far, appears to be holding.
